London Heathrow Travel Policy
Due to the extreme impact to operations at London Heathrow, UK, American Airlines, British Airways and Iberia offer customers the convenience to change their travel plans. Customers ticketed to travel on AA/AA*/BA/IB to/from/through the airports listed below may change flights as shown below.

If you are traveling to/from/through:
London Heathrow, U.K. (LHR)

On the following date:
December 19-31, 2010

And your ticket was issued no later than:
December 19, 2010

You may begin travel as late as:
January 7- April 3, 2011 / December 19, 2010 - January 6, 2011

Original inventory required?
Yes / No

One ticketed change is allowed with no penalty.

I flew LHR-AMS (BA) return yesterday.

Very little impact at LHR so far, most of the problems that there have been mostly related to a long queue for de-icing last night or problems elsewhere, nothing actually affecting landing at LHR.

I wouldn't be expecting problems unless the weather around there changes dramatically.
